Prof. Dr. Gregor Gassner, Colloquium, DLR Braunschweig, Germany:
n this talk, we present the newest developments for discontinuous Galerkin spectral element methods applied to advection dominated problems, such as the compressible Navier-Stokes equations. The talk includes the numerical stability analysis of the method, some turbulence modelling aspects and considerations, limiting strategies based on compatible Legendre-Gauss-Lobatto subcell finite volume methods, and discussions about the overall computational performance.
